Webb9 aug. 2024 · Thyme also has anti-inflammatory properties [2] , making it totally ideal for getting rid of coughs and improving respiratory disorders. Consuming 2 cups of thyme tea on a daily basis can greatly help speed up the improvement process. Expectorante natural Webb5 aug. 2024 · Caffeine has a tendency to make acid reflex worse, causing the acid to rise up into the throat. In turn, this results in a sore throat and prolonged bouts of coughing. Even if you haven’t been diagnosed with acid reflux, caffeine can increase acid production in general. Once again, this can cause irritation in the throat.

Webb18 sep. 2024 · Plantago or Plantain leaves, when taken as an herbal tea, can help open up the airways during a cold or flu and help expel phlegm and suppress cough in patients suffering from dry cough. This makes it one of the sought-after herbal remedies for respiratory system improvement in affected individuals. 15. Sage
